You built something extraordinary.
And it might be quietly costing you everything.
I’ve been in this industry for 36 years. I’ve stood on the production side of Jazz Fest, Presidential Inaugurations, NFL events — stages that take your breath away. I know what it feels like when the crowd arrives and everything you sacrificed to make it happen suddenly makes sense.
I also know what it feels like at 2am the week before load-in, when your best department head is one resignation letter away from leaving. When you’re the person everyone needs to be strong — and you haven’t had a full night’s sleep in three weeks. When “the show must go on” stops being a rallying cry and starts being a warning sign.
Our industry talks about production excellence. We celebrate the wins. What we haven’t built — until now — is the leadership infrastructure to sustain the people producing all of it.
74% of live events professionals report poor mental health directly caused by their work. Suicide rates in our industry run 5–10 times higher than the general population. These aren’t abstract statistics — they’re our colleagues, our crews, our emerging leaders.
Source: Skiddle Industry Report, 2024The problem isn’t that festival professionals aren’t resilient. We are the most resilient people on the planet. The problem is that resilience without a leadership framework to hold it eventually breaks. And when it breaks, it takes institutional knowledge, team culture, and the next generation of leaders with it.
This industry deserves better than grinding through.
